Output 71f32e136fc4ee527544914763041b6917630f2b690789b9f4b21e51297d2390:1

value
18151245
script pubkey
OP_HASH160 OP_PUSHBYTES_20 356d19e3edfa80ff57cbae516c80b8e8998f990b OP_EQUAL
address
MCmek5QwLijnqaBPGp7Y6Gd3oJya5oxoTn
transaction
71f32e136fc4ee527544914763041b6917630f2b690789b9f4b21e51297d2390
spent
true